3 >> In fact, I gave an example in the email you replied to, from the latest
4 >> Portage CVS :-) :
5 >>
6 >> myworld=open("/var/cache/edb/world","w")
7 >>
8 >> No setting of ROOT can possibly cause this to open any file other than
9 >> "/var/cache/edb/world". I want it to access the file
10 >> "$ROOT/var/cache/edb/world" instead.
11
12 d> actually you are incorrect. It does reference
13 d> $ROOT/var/cache/edb/world just try it and see.
14
15 Hm. I'm assuming this didn't work for us before (the original work on
16 this was done with a pre-2.0.49 Portage last summer), but I'll try it
17 again with the latest vanilla Portage.
18
19 d> IIRC there was a time when the only thing that was read from / and
20 d> not $ROOT was make.conf
21
22 d> I think that may have changed, I recall somebody mentioning a patch
23 d> on IRC.
24
25 That would need to change in my environment: I need make.conf to be
26 local to the ROOT as well.
